Piers Steel, author of The Procrastination Equation: How to Stop Putting Things Off and Start Getting Stuff Done, is an internationally recognized authority on the science of motivation and productivity. A Distinguished Research Chair at the University of Calgary’s Haskayne School of Business, Steel combines decades of academic rigor with real-world insights, drawing from his PhD in Industrial/Organizational Psychology and meta-analyses of over 800 studies on procrastination.

His work, blending psychology and self-help, has been featured in The New Yorker, Psychology Today, and Scientific American, establishing him as a leading voice in behavior change.

Steel’s research-driven approach to overcoming delay, rooted in his development of the Procrastination Equation framework, bridges theoretical models with actionable strategies. Alongside his acclaimed book, he has contributed to organizational behavior literature and engages audiences through global speaking engagements. The Procrastination Equation explains procrastination through a scientific formula: Motivation = (Expectancy × Value) / (Impulsiveness × Delay). Dr. Piers Steel combines psychology, neuroscience, and behavioral economics to reveal why we delay tasks and how to boost motivation using evidence-based strategies.

The core framework identifies four procrastination drivers:

  • Expectancy (confidence in success)
  • Value (task reward magnitude)
  • Impulsiveness (distraction susceptibility)
  • Delay (time until reward realization)
    Mastering these variables helps increase motivation and reduce delay.

Key evidence-based tactics include:

  • Breaking tasks into high-success-probability steps (boost expectancy)
  • Attaching immediate rewards to progress (increase value)
  • Using focus apps to limit distractions (reduce impulsiveness)
  • Creating artificial deadlines with penalties (shorten delay)

Practical uses include:

  • Career: Negotiating milestone-based bonuses to shorten reward delays
  • Fitness: Pairing workouts with enjoyable podcasts to increase task value
  • Education: Using pre-commitment contracts to reduce impulsiveness
